2 questions please... Just purchased Amelia so newly integrated PayPal and Google Calendar...
1) Paypal Integration - all works fab, monies received etc, apart from the 'Order Details' for each Amelia transaction is blank. Its just showing a price but no description. how do I get the description sent to PayPal?
2) Google Calendar. Again all working AOK, however its only shows the service selected. Is there a way of sending further details to calendar so I can see the at least the customer name in the appointment? To see the extras paid for would be a bonus.

1) Unfortunately, this is the way the connection with PayPal works for now. But I forwarded this to the development team so they can check out if there is some solution to send some meta data to PayPal.
2) Yes, you can send more information about the appointments in Amelia to your Google calendar. You just need to copy/paste the wanted placeholders (which you will find by clicking on '</> Show Email Placeholders' in Amelia -> Notifications) to the 'Event Description: ' field in Amelia -> Settings -> Google Calendar Settings.
